summaryrefslogtreecommitdiff
path: root/devel/bfg/Makefile
blob: b2203a3e2086fe6e2c184af74ce0c57420732aac (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
# $NetBSD: Makefile,v 1.1.1.1 2016/12/15 20:25:04 abs Exp $

DISTNAME=	bfg-1.12.14
CATEGORIES=	devel
MASTER_SITES=	http://repo1.maven.org/maven2/com/madgag/bfg/1.12.14/
EXTRACT_SUFX=	.jar

MAINTAINER=	pkgsrc-users@NetBSD.org
HOMEPAGE=	https://rtyley.github.io/bfg-repo-cleaner/
COMMENT=	BFG git Repo-Cleaner
LICENSE=	gnu-gpl-v3

USE_JAVA=	run
USE_JAVA2=	7

INSTALLATION_DIRS=	bin share/${PKGBASE}

do-build:
	printf "#!/bin/sh\n${PKG_JAVA_HOME}/bin/java -jar ${PREFIX}/share/${PKGBASE}/${PKGBASE}.jar \$${1:+\"\$$@\"}\n" > ${WRKDIR}/${PKGBASE}.sh

do-install:
	${INSTALL_DATA} ${WRKDIR}/${DISTNAME}.jar ${DESTDIR}${PREFIX}/share/${PKGBASE}/${PKGBASE}.jar
	${INSTALL_SCRIPT} ${WRKDIR}/${PKGBASE}.sh ${DESTDIR}${PREFIX}/bin/${PKGBASE}

.include "../../mk/java-vm.mk"
.include "../../mk/bsd.pkg.mk"